The Diploma in Art Foundations: Studio Art at CUNY Borough of Manhattan Community College provides students with a comprehensive exploration of visual art principles and techniques. This program is designed for aspiring artists looking to build a strong foundation in various mediums, including painting, drawing, sculpture, and digital art. Throughout the course, students will engage in hands-on projects that foster creativity and critical thinking.
Students will learn essential skills in various artistic practices, developing their unique artistic voice while also gaining knowledge of art history and theory. The curriculum typically includes studio courses where students can experiment with different materials and techniques, coupled with lectures that provide a contextual understanding of the art world.

To qualify for the Diploma in Art Foundations: Studio Art, applicants typically need to have completed a secondary education or equivalent. A portfolio showcasing their artistic work may also be required as part of the admission process. This portfolio allows the faculty to assess the applicant's skills and artistic potential.
International students are generally expected to have a minimum proficiency in English. Common requirements include an IELTS score of around 6.0 or an equivalent TOEFL score. These scores demonstrate a student’s ability to succeed in an English-speaking academic environment.
International students must secure a student visa to study in the destination country. Required documents typically include proof of acceptance into the program, financial statements, and a valid passport. It is essential for prospective students to check the official immigration requirements for their specific situation.
